Mariah Has Another Hit, And Wins Two New Fans

This past Labor Day weekend, my mom and I went to the mall in search of new perfume. Currently, I have L'Instant de Guerlain, Hanae Mori Butterfly, Vera Wang Princess, and Comptoir Sud Pacifique Vanille Abricot on heavy rotation…and I was looking for something lighter. My mom, already bored with the Calvin Klein Euphoria my Dad bought her for her birthday, was also looking for something different.

Unfortunately, neither of us found a new signature scent. But we did manage to find a fragrance that we both agreed on.

When I sprayed M by Mariah Carey (a collaboration between the singer and Elizbeth Arden) on the tester strip, I didn’t expect much. My Mom didn’t even want to smell it, explaining that she “doesn’t care for Mariah.”

We both assumed the scent would be somewhat strong and garish – like its namesake. But to our surprise, M was light and creamy, inviting and refined.

Perfumers Carlos Benaim and Loc Dong describe the inspiration for the fragrance:

“By combining two very contrasted notes, an exotic Tahitian Tiare flower with a deliciously warm marshmallow, we wanted to express Mariah's utmost femininity and undeniable sensuality in one strong statement. We then incorporated other facets, such as a Moroccan Incense Amber accord, to bring an element of mystery that lingers on skin. This harmonious balance of Mariah's favorite scents and memories is at the heart of this creation."
